> bio_map_kern() returns an ERR_PTR() not NULL.
>
> Found by smatch (http://repo.or.cz/w/smatch.git). Compile tested.
>
> regards,
> dan carpenter
>
> Signed-off-by: Dan Carpenter <error27@gmail.com>
> Signed-off-by: Boaz Harrosh <bharrosh@panasas.com>
> ---
> drivers/scsi/osd/osd_initiator.c | 4 ++--
> 1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/scsi/osd/osd_initiator.c b/drivers/scsi/osd/osd_initiator.c
> index 2a5f077..76de889 100644
> --- a/drivers/scsi/osd/osd_initiator.c
> +++ b/drivers/scsi/osd/osd_initiator.c
> @@ -612,9 +612,9 @@ static int _osd_req_list_objects(struct osd_request *or,
>
> WARN_ON(or->in.bio);
> bio = bio_map_kern(q, list, len, or->alloc_flags);
> - if (!bio) {
> + if (IS_ERR(bio)) {
> OSD_ERR("!!! Failed to allocate list_objects BIO\n");
> - return -ENOMEM;
> + return PTR_ERR(bio);
> }
>
> bio->bi_rw &= ~(1 << BIO_RW);
